VN-Index ended a series of 5 losing sessions with a sharp improvement in liquidity when increasing by nearly 55% compared to September 29. Resonance from the drop of US stocks and profit-taking in the last session of the week, month and quarter made the market shake strongly and then suddenly reversed to recover at the end of the session

Asia-Pacific stock markets fell sharply in the last trading session of the third quarter. In Japan, the Nikkei 225 index fell 0.39% to 25,937.21 points. South Korea's Kospi index fell 0.71% to 2,155.49. The Shanghai index fell 0.55% to 3,024.39 points. On the other hand, Hong Kong's Hang Seng index increased slightly by 0.33%

On September 29, The Ministry of Finance announced the total state budget revenue in 9 months is estimated at 1,327.3 trillion VND, equal to 94% of the estimate. In 9M/2022, domestic revenue reached 88.9% of the estimate, an increase of 18.8% (excluding land use levy, lottery collection, capital recovery, dividends, profit, profit after tax and difference) revenue and expenditure of the State Bank, domestic tax and fee revenue reached 87.3% of the estimate, an increase of 15.3% over the same period)

SBV has just sent a report to the Economic Committee of the National Assembly, specifying the direction of capital increase of commercial banks, especially with the "Big 4" due to the dominant ownership of the State. Regarding the increase of charter capital of BID, VCB, CTG, SBV has sent a written request to the Ministry of Finance to consider and comment on the distribution of profits in 2021 as a basis for submission to the competent authorities for consideration. Regarding capital increase for commercial banks: In 2022, SBV has approved in writing to increase charter capital for 15 commercial banks, in which, the increase in charter capital of these banks are mainly from the bank's equity

FPT: FPT's technology division is developed by 4 subsidiaries: FPT Software, FPT IS, FPT Digital, and FPT Smart Cloud. In which, the technology sector contributes 57-58% of revenue and 44-45% of the group's profit. Software export is still the main source of revenue and profit for FPT's technology sector. The domestic information technology market recorded a breakthrough in 2021 thanks to digital transformation promoted strongly due to the epidemic
